Output 28224017fcd05e63278ac2eb19a3febcfed198c2abe3217f1c591b11bb932821:74

value
14348907
script pubkey
OP_0 OP_PUSHBYTES_20 a87fa0b8b082ee22dedeace5a429e7de92c12c19
address
bc1q4pl6pw9ssthz9hk74nj6g208m6fvztqeek0cp8
transaction
28224017fcd05e63278ac2eb19a3febcfed198c2abe3217f1c591b11bb932821
confirmations
133734
spent
true